Have you checked the brake safety switch? If the o-rings in it are no good, the brakes won't work very well. To check it, just take out the switch. If there is fluid behind the switch, the o-rings are no good. If no fluid, it is fine.
This was the problem on my Dad's Cuda. We could not get the brakes to lock up (disc/drum). We tried everything, new master, booster, fluid, rebuild calipers and wheel cylinders. Nothing worked until we rebuilt the safety switch. Brakes work great now.
